Synopsis
Tall Man Riding (1955) centers on a former cowhand who comes back to New Mexico after striking it rich in the cattle business. As he attempts to settle old debts and rekindle a romance while powerful local interests seek to dominate the region through intimidation and violence, tensions escalate into a confrontation that threatens the future of the community. This western drama examines integrity and perseverance within a frontier society divided by greed and ambition, as personal loyalties and economic interests collide, with ranching disputes, corruption, and frontier justice.
